CINCPACFLT (Commander in Chief Pacific Fleet), SPINTCOM (Special Intelligence Communications), FOSIC (Fleet Operations and Information Center), SCIF, NSGA (Naval Security Group Activity), NSGD (Naval Security Group Detachment), NCU (Naval Communications Unit), COMSPAWARSYSCOM (Commander Space and Naval Warfare Systems Command), NCTS (Naval Computer and Telecommunications Station).Response by PO1 William "Chip" Nagel made Jan 23 at 2016 11:01 AM2016-01-23T11:01:45-05:002016-01-23T11:01:45-05:00CPT Jack Durish1254322<div class="images-v2-count-0"></div>"True Virgins Make Dull Company" (TVMDC) It's an acronym used in piloting to remind navigators of the relationship between True Course (plotted on charts with true north aligned to the poles), Variation (the difference between true north and magnetic north caused by the shifting location of the magnetic influences surrounding the earth), Magnetic North (the direction in which a compass would point if there were no other influences), Deviation (magnetic influences such as the surrounding metal structures of a vessel or aircraft), and Compass Course (the actual bearing compass direction used to make good a course plotted on a chart). The reverse acronym used in converting a compass course so that it can be plotted on a chart is "Can Dead Men Vote Twice" (CDMVT).Response by CPT Jack Durish made Jan 23 at 2016 1:59 PM2016-01-23T13:59:55-05:002016-01-23T13:59:55-05:00CPT Jack Durish1254335<div class="images-v2-count-0"></div>Forgive me for double-dipping on this discussion thread, but I just finished scanning all the accumulated comments and was surprised to find that no one mentioned "PFC" - That's Proud Fu*king Civilian.Response by CPT Jack Durish made Jan 23 at 2016 2:05 PM2016-01-23T14:05:34-05:002016-01-23T14:05:34-05:00CPT Private RallyPoint Member1254939<div class="images-v2-count-0"></div>AYFKM?<br />CF.Response by CPT Private RallyPoint Member made Jan 23 at 2016 9:30 PM2016-01-23T21:30:14-05:002016-01-23T21:30:14-05:001LT William Clardy1255180<div class="images-v2-count-0"></div>While I am very fluent in both TLAs (Three-Letter Acronyms) and FLAs (Four-Letter...), I see the most common ones (including my own favorite R.O.A.D.) have already been offered up.Response by 1LT William Clardy made Jan 24 at 2016 12:04 AM2016-01-24T00:04:02-05:002016-01-24T00:04:02-05:00SPC Aaron Stephens1256088<div class="images-v2-count-0"></div>TWAT- traveling wave amplification tube.Response by SPC Aaron Stephens made Jan 24 at 2016 3:19 PM2016-01-24T15:19:48-05:002016-01-24T15:19:48-05:00SPC James Blackwell1256138<div class="images-v2-count-0"></div>WOMBAT: Waste Of Money, Brains And TimeResponse by SPC James Blackwell made Jan 24 at 2016 3:40 PM2016-01-24T15:40:33-05:002016-01-24T15:40:33-05:00Lt Col Private RallyPoint Member1256210<div class="images-v2-count-0"></div>My previous deputy called our daily staff meetings a BOGSAT (bunch of guys (or/and gals) sitting around talking).
